I thought long and hard about this one. What was my best race ever? My first half? The Glass Slipper Challenge? Ultimately, the best race I ever ran would have to be my first 10K. It was my first “longer distance” race after completing 5Ks for a couples of years.

I think I was more nervous for this race than I was for my first half, surprisingly. The race was called the St. Pete Beach Classic. I was familiar with this race as my sister had ran it several times in the past. When I first made the decision to push past my comfort zone and register for a 10K the St. Pete Beach Classic was the first and only race to come to mind for a 10K.

The memory of that morning is still fresh in my head. It was the coldest weather I had run in to date (at that time) with a temperature of 52 degrees and windy conditions. I remember running out to Target the night before to pick up a pair of running tights and a long sleeve shirt to wear. Today, I laugh at that memory as 52 degree for me now is t-shirt and capris running attire.

I wont spend too much detailing out the race as you can read that on my recap here.

I think what made this race so special to me was that it was where I pushed past my boundaries of running a 5K and challenged myself to a whole new level. Surely I had a couple 4 and 5 miler training runs, and one 6 mile run leading up to the race, but a training run and a race run are completely different. I tried not to focus too much on my time, I just wanted to finish and finish strong. Looking back I am proud of myself for being able to run just about the entire race, with the exception of one walk break where I had to use my inhaler due to the colder air. I crossed the finish line with a time of 1:07:46, a pace of 10:48! My average pace time for 5ks, at that time, was around 11:30. Seeing those results on my Garmin was such an aww moment.
